Koeda T, Moriguchi M
Jpn J Antibiot. 1979 Feb;32(2):171-9.
The peri- and post-natal study of fosfomycin-Na (FOM-Na) was undertaken in Wistar rats. FOM-Na was administered intraperitoneally at dose levels of 250, 750 and 1,500 mg/kg/day from day 14 of gestation to day 21 after delivery. It could be concluded that delivery rate in the 750 and 1,500 mg/kg groups decreased, but no influence of FOM-Na was found on postnatal development of offspring (F1) and neonate (F2) without maximum dose.
